Output 8443bfdd71c3071f81cc957b794bf40a98d4edf7929b05230897c14fa2014256:0

value
266500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f649a50d4966f925bb1b73e8e4867d654dc3a4 OP_EQUAL
address
3FTEKgjpFkLEs23RSZdDKnP88Znm8BKteh
transaction
8443bfdd71c3071f81cc957b794bf40a98d4edf7929b05230897c14fa2014256
spent
true